SoftBank positioned to benefit from OpenAI IPO
SoftBank stands to gain as a major beneficiary and material catalyst from OpenAI's impending public offering.
The argument
The hosts highlighted an analyst note from Cantor Fitzgerald arguing that OpenAI's aggressive push to IPO ahead of Anthropic, highlighted by its confidential S-1 filing, serves as a major positive catalyst for SoftBank as a key shareholder.
